Tragedy in Ahmedabad: Investigations Continue into Air India Crash
A week after the Air India plane crash in Ahmedabad claimed 270 lives, investigation progresses with a focus on decoding the black box. The Boeing 787-8 Dreamliner crashed moments after takeoff, killing many. Tributes pour in for victims as authorities work on identifying bodies, with ongoing debates on aviation safety protocols.

In the wake of the tragic Air India plane crash in Ahmedabad, which resulted in the loss of 270 lives, investigations are intensifying to determine the cause. The ill-fated Dreamliner's black box retrieval and analysis remain a priority for the Aircraft Accident Investigation Bureau (AAIB).
The Boeing 787-8 Dreamliner, on its way to London, crashed into a medical hostel complex shortly after departing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el International Airport. Recovery efforts have identified 215 victims through DNA testing, amidst the ongoing examination of debris and evidence.
As families mourn, Commerce and Industry Minister Piyush Goyal paid tribute to the victims in London, emphasizing the need for stricter aviation safety protocols. Meanwhile, funeral ceremonies for the crash victims, including crew members, have been conducted.
